What is engineered wood flooring?
Engineered wood is real wood on top, with stable layers beneath.
What Is the Difference Between Engineered Wood Flooring and Solid Wood Flooring?
The main difference between engineered wood flooring and solid wood flooring lies in their construction, durability, and suitability for different environments. While both offer the natural beauty of real wood, their structural differences impact performance, maintenance, and installation options.
Is engineered wood flooring suitable for kitchens?
Yes, engineered wood flooring is a fantastic choice for kitchens! Unlike solid wood flooring, which can be prone to warping when exposed to moisture or temperature changes, engineered wood is designed to be much more stable.
